The Department

Our top-ranking wealth planning team has a number of market-leading partners who advise domestic and internationally based clients and their family offices in relation to trusts and tax, as well as estate and succession issues. 

Our team helps successful families and entrepreneurs around the world structure their assets in a way that will preserve their wealth now and for future generations.  We advise on all aspects of wealth structuring, using domestic and international trusts and foundations, private trust companies in local as well as offshore jurisdictions and we co-ordinate the acquisition of appropriate investments. 

Our clients are international families with family members who are living across the world and have US connections and want to understand their tax exposure and where possible engage in planning to mitigate it. 

 

The role

The role is for a US qualified tax and wealth planning lawyer interested in an associate position in Singapore.  The associate would join a team of over ten tax and private client and practitioners in Singapore, many of whom are US qualified.  The team regularly works with its colleagues in other offices Hong Kong, Tokyo, London, New York and San Francisco among others.

The associate will advise high net worth individuals, their families on US and international tax, trust and estate planning issues as well as on US expatriation and immigration issues and IRS Voluntary Disclosure programs.  They also will advise on structuring investments into businesses and real estate as well as into funds.  They will work with US and international trusts and foundations, private trust companies, holding companies and family offices and advise on FATCA and CRS reporting issues.
